tall, 6" wide and 2-1/2" deep.The TEK Toothbrush hit the market in the late
1920s. Despite the fact that few Americans brushed their teeth regularly,
Johnson & Johnson understood the importance of daily oral care. When sales were
low, the company continued researching to improve the product. In 1939, it
released a new TEK Toothbrush.
